On January 10, 2017, the body of five-year-old Ashley Zhao was discovered in her family’s restaurant in Jackson Township, Stark County. In response to her death, the local police department, the Ohio Bureau of Criminal Investigation, and the Federal Bureau of Investigation all started looking into what happened.

On January 9, 2017, Ashley Zhao vanished from her parents’ restaurant, Ang’s Asian Cuisine. She was reported missing at approximately 9:00 PM on the same day.

The pair first told authorities that they last saw Ashley sleeping in a makeshift bed at the restaurant’s rear door, which led investigators to suspect she fled away. However, Ashley’s body was soon discovered inside the restaurant.

Ang’s Asian Cuisine. Photo credit: dailymail.co.uk/GoogleMaps

On January 11, Ming Ming Chen and Liang Zhao were arrested for their daughter’s death.
